POSITION SUMMARY
The Solution Consultant for Kubix Link is a key contributor in implementing Lectra’s Kubix Link solution for customers.
RESPONSIBILITIES
The main responsibilities of the Solution Consultant are:
- Engaging with clients to identify needs and define high-level requirements.
- Translating clients’ requirements into detailed functional and technical designs.
- Facilitating alignments between design and development based on requirements.
- Collaborating with developers to ensure accurate implementation.
- Supporting the development team by clarifying requirements and resolving issues.
- Verifying technical feasibility and supporting the execution of UAT (User Acceptance Testing).
- Training the client's project team on initial training, implemented solution, initial loading, and post go-live support (part of hypercare).
PROFILE
- Master’s degree in one of the following fields: software engineering, computer science, digital technologies, electronics, Information Systems or related area will be required.
- 5 years or above working experience will be a minimum, among which, 3 years direct relevant solution consultancy experience will be ideal. Experience in Fashion industry will be preferred, along with the number of different positions occupied covering different levels of the product lifecycle management (Line Planning, Costing, Creation, Pattern design, Manufacturing, Sourcing…).
KEY COMPETENCIES
- Business knowledge: capacity to understand fashion clients' needs and fashion processes (design, development, merchandising, supply chain, quality).
- IT solutions knowledge: capacity to understand processes and technologies such as PLM, PIM, DAM, ERP solutions, etc. ideally in Saas mode.
- Integration and web services knowledge
- Solution design knowledge: ability to design a solution, define a data model and contribute to the integration of the solution.
- Requirements management: capacity to collect, formalize and validate requirements.
- Team collaboration: capacity to collaborate with internal stakeholders and share relevant information with developers and project managers.
- Stakeholder management: demonstrates strong interpersonal, communication, presentation and active listening skills; capacity to influence, negotiate and ensure customer engagement; ability to manage internal resources and conflict resolutions.
- Fluency in English and German is a must, and other Scandinavian languages are a plus.
TRAVEL
- The position is remote. The candidate ideally resides in Germany.
- There will be approximately 30% of travel to customer sites in DACH, Nordics and Lectra offices.
